No, the PCMCIA-GPIB+ will never work under Windows NT. The problem is that PCCard services were not cleanly incorporated into the NT operating system so the services they provide are very minimal. The PCMCIA-GPIB+ card has two different logical devices on the single card. The NT PCCard services were not written to detect a card that has two different logical devices. When Microsoft came out with Windows 2000, they put a clean implementation of PCCard services so a PCMCIA card with multiple interfaces is detected. As of now, you will only be able to use the controller portion of the card, but it will work under Windows 2000. Unfortunately, there is nothing that NI can do to allow the PCMCIA-GPIB+ board to work under Window NTx.
